Pachydiscus (Parapachydiscus) woodringi Reeside 1947 (ammonite)

Cephalopoda - Ammonitida - Pachydiscidae

Full reference: J. B. Reeside. 1947. Upper Cretaceous ammonites from Haiti. United States Geological Survey Professional Paper 214(A):1-5

Belongs to Pachydiscus (Parapachydiscus) according to J. B. Reeside 1947

Type specimen: USNM 104158, a shell. Its type locality is USGS Loc. M18724, which is in a Coniacian coastal sandstone in Haiti.

Ecology: fast-moving nektonic carnivore

Distribution:

• Cretaceous of Haiti (2 collections)

Total: 2 collections each including a single occurrence
